This week we talk to Crohn's patient Jodie Delay who also has a brother and son with Crohn's. We discussed accepting and feeling all emotions, how empowering and exciting advocacy can be, and how you can choose to live joyfully even in the face of adversity (#ginandjoy). Jodie also gives us some parenting hacks and reminds us that just because you may have IBD, doesn't mean that you can't live out your "Impossibly Big Dreams."
